| Kingdom | Organic compounds |
|---|---|
| Superclass | Lipids and lipid-like molecules |
| Clase | Glycerolipids |
| Subclass | Triradylcglycerols |
| Intermediate Tree Nodes | Not available |
| Direct Parent | Trialkylglycerols |
| Alternative Parents | Glycerol ethers Dialkyl ethers Primary alcohols Hydrocarbon derivatives |
| Molecular Framework | Aliphatic acyclic compounds |
| Substituents | Trialkylglycerol - Glycerol ether - Ether - Dialkyl ether - Organic oxygen compound - Hydrocarbon derivative - Primary alcohol - Organooxygen compound - Alcohol - Aliphatic acyclic compound |
| Descripción | This compound belongs to the class of organic compounds known as trialkylglycerols. These are triradylglycerols that carry three chains attached to the glycerol moiety through ether linkages. |

| Solubilidad | H2O: soluble |
|---|---|
| Índice de refracción | n20/D 1.473 (lit.) |
| Punto de inflamación (°F) | Not applicable |
| Punto de inflamación (°C) | Not applicable |
| Punto de ebullición (°C) | >200℃ (lit.) |
| Punto de fusión (°C) | softening point −6-(−4)℃ |
| Peso molecular | 224.250 g/mol |
